NBA’er Gilbert Arenas Served Child Support Papers During Half-Time, Requesting $109K Monthly in Support

How. Freaking. Embarrassing. Gilbert Arenas, who recently had some very public baby-momma drama with his ex-girlfriend, Laura Govan, was served child support papers during his basketball game. Technically, it wasn’t DURING the game. As he left the court at halftime on Thursday night’s game against the Miami Heat, he was served. In the petition, Govan is seeking $109,000 in monthly support payments from Arenas and $1.3 million annually.

Arenas didn’t respond, but his attorney, Lisa Fishberg released a written statement. “This is a private matter involving young children. It is inappropriate for Ms. Govan and her attorneys to attempt to turn it into a public spectacle.” A hearing in the case has been set for March 8 in Los Angeles.
